I'm using some bday money to finally get a blu ray player and I'm currently torn between gettting a PS3 or a stand alone player like the Samsung BD-1600 ($250) or the BD-3600 ($350). Based on reviews I have read those are the best ones so far next to the PS3. My hesitation on pulling the trigger on the PS3 is for a couple reasons:

1. it's going to be $50-$100 more than the stand alone players I am looking at

2. I already have the Xbox 360 and my brother and our friends have them...it's the only gaming console I will use

3. No IR sensor so I can't use my LG Harmony universal remote

From what i can read the ps3 is hands down the best player out there and based on the cost of current players it makes sense to spend a little more and get an HD gaming console...but what if you already have the 360?? That is where I'm struggling.

Anyone have either of these players or another one to suggest? And who loves the PS3 as a blu ray player?

If you're a gamer of any kind, it probably makes more sense to spend a couple extra bucks and get the PS3, even if you go for the cheapest one. That way you get more functionality for your buck, plus who knows what games may come down the line that you can't get for the 360.

As far as comparing it to a standard Blu Ray player, I can't do that because I only have the PS3. It does a good job playing movies though, and it seems to be able to keep track of where you were on discs even if you eject them (at least, it did that for my cousin last night).
